The user can view these scenes directly on the computer screen, wall screen, stereo glasses, virtual reality glasses, etc. He can also move inside a virtual scene and interact with its objects. In turn, the environment can also change. This allows modeling of various situations (situational modeling) in the virtual environment system. With such modeling, some static or dynamic situation is set in the virtual environment system in which the operator must perform the tasks assigned to him. A mechanism for setting situations by changing a virtual three-dimensional scene using configuration files and virtual control panels is proposed. A special language and editor has been developed for writing configuration files and for creating virtual control panels. Leading publishers of scientific journals, as a rule, post lists of referring publications on the web pages of their articles. In Russia, the placement of lists of citing publications has not yet become the norm, but it is gradually becoming widespread. The reverse bibliography is extremely interesting to the reader since it allows you to find out in which direction the research presented in the original edition is developing. A traditional bibliography, i.e. an ordinary bibliographic list of references, can successfully exist both in a printed publication and online. In contrast, the list of referring publications is essentially an exclusively online, dynamic structure formed “on the fly” on the screen of an online reader. The list of referring publications always brings the reader a fresh current state of accumulated bibliographic data. Publications appearing on the Internet and indexed in bibliographic databases containing a link to the scientific work in question in their bibliography are reflected here almost immediately. The implementation of the list of referring publications in a number of characteristic projects is considered.
